More Premium Hugo Themes Premium React Themes

Electron React Bloatfree

A simple alternative to electron-react-boilerplate

Electron React Bloatfree

A simple alternative to electron-react-boilerplate

Author Avatar Theme by nnmrts
Github Stars Github Stars: 17
Last Commit Last Commit: Sep 19, 2024 -
First Commit Created: Jun 19, 2023 -
Electron React Bloatfree screenshot

Overview

Electron React Bloatfree is a streamlined solution built on the Electron React Boilerplate, designed for developers who want a cleaner starting point for their desktop applications. By stripping away unnecessary tools and features like Redux and React Router, this repository aims to provide a more flexible and customizable experience. This makes it especially useful for those who want to focus on their app without the overhead of boilerplate code that often comes with more complex setups.

The essence of this repository lies in its simplicity, allowing developers to create a desktop app using React while avoiding the hassle of cleaning out a bloated package.json file. Whether you prefer a minimalistic approach or want the option to tailor your development environment, Electron React Bloatfree offers a solid foundation that is easy to work with.

Features

  • Lightweight Setup: Built without unnecessary dependencies like Redux and React Router, providing a more focused starting point for your app.
  • Flexible Structure: Freedom to customize your project by easily removing elements like linting configurations, package managers, and other non-essential files.
  • Efficient Development: Includes a hot-module-replacement mode to facilitate real-time updates during development, enhancing productivity.
  • Maintainable Code: Supports essential tools like eslint and flow, which can be tailored or removed as per your project needs.
  • Ease of Use: Simple installation process through git and yarn, streamlining the setup phase.
  • Customizable Linting: Suggested changes to eslint configurations allow developers to create a coding environment that truly fits their style.
  • Future-ready: Plans for a lite version indicate ongoing development and support, ensuring users access to an even more minimal setup when needed.